So now i'm on kangaroo island about 30km (20 miles) from Kingscote--the nearest town. i live in a caravan (RV) next to the house. I eat, shower, and pretty much do everything but sleep, in the house. i get up at 7am--rather i am FORCED AWAKE at 7am by about every single bird on the planet screaming outside my windows, "Get up you lazy turd!" It's good...really, because i go to work at 8am and i don't possess an alarm clock.

Bryan's Day:

First i feed the chucks (chickens, duh). Then i water the 300 million (20-ish) guinea pigs, Tammy the wallaby, and Kairoo the kangaroo. i am in love with kairoo and want to take her home with me. not really what everyone had in mind when they teased me about coming home with a wife, but whatever...i heart Kairoo. after making sure the love of my life has water, i sweep her poop off the walkway. swoon...
then it's off to work with Bob on his huge, 500 acre farm. Sunday we chased cows with his truck (lots of mooing was heard from the cows...and bryan too). Monday we helped put up a "vermine proof" fence for Bob's son-in-law, Tim. i have a sneaky suspicion that the "fence" part is the only truth in the matter. Today we burned branches on Bob's farm, picked up scrap wire, and I mowed a field with a tractor. that's right...i am now a Tractor Operator. eat your hearts out you non-tractor operators!
